MiracalizeLearn something new today.Contact

AI Lead Score Calculation Method: A Complete Guide to Smarter Sales Prioritization

·10 min read
Share

TL;DR

Your sales team is drowning in leads. Some will convert. Most will not. And without a reliable way to tell the difference, your reps waste hours chasing prospects who were never going to buy.

Your sales team is drowning in leads. Some will convert. Most will not. And without a reliable way to tell the difference, your reps waste hours chasing prospects who were never going to buy.

That is where the AI lead score calculation method comes in. Instead of relying on gut feelings or rigid point systems, this approach uses machine learning to analyze patterns in your data and predict which leads are most likely to become customers.

In this guide, we will break down exactly how the AI lead score calculation method works, walk through the formulas behind it, explore different scoring models, and give you a practical roadmap for implementation. Whether you are running a B2B SaaS company or managing a growing sales pipeline, understanding this method will help you prioritize leads that actually convert.

What Is the AI Lead Score Calculation Method?

The AI lead score calculation method is a data-driven approach that uses machine learning algorithms to assign a numerical value to each lead based on their likelihood to convert. Unlike traditional lead scoring, where marketing teams manually assign points for actions like downloading a whitepaper or visiting a pricing page, AI scoring analyzes hundreds of data signals simultaneously to find patterns humans would miss.

Traditional scoring works like a checklist. A lead gets 10 points for opening an email, 20 points for requesting a demo, and 5 points for matching your target industry. The problem is that these weights are based on assumptions, not evidence. And they stay static even as buyer behavior changes.

The AI lead score calculation method flips this on its head. It learns from your historical conversion data to figure out which signals actually predict a sale. Maybe leads who visit your pricing page three times in a week close at 4x the rate. Maybe leads from companies with 50 to 200 employees convert more reliably than enterprise accounts. The algorithm surfaces these patterns automatically and updates itself over time.

This approach ties directly into using behavioral data to identify and convert leads faster, because the AI model thrives on the same engagement signals your marketing team is already tracking.

How AI Lead Score Calculation Works: The Core Process

The AI lead score calculation method follows a structured pipeline that turns raw data into actionable scores. Here is how each phase works.

Data Collection

Everything starts with data. AI lead scoring systems pull from multiple sources to build a complete picture of each lead:

  • Demographic data: job title, seniority, department, location
  • Firmographic data: company size, industry, revenue, technology stack
  • Behavioral data: website visits, content downloads, email engagement, form submissions
  • Engagement data: sales call history, chat interactions, event attendance, product trials
  • Third-party data: intent signals, social activity, funding rounds, hiring trends

The more data points you feed into the model, the more accurate your scores become. But quality matters more than quantity. Incomplete or outdated records will skew your results and lead to unreliable predictions.

Feature Engineering

Raw data is not ready for modeling. Feature engineering transforms it into meaningful variables that the algorithm can work with. For example, instead of feeding in "visited pricing page" as a single event, the system might create a composite feature like "pricing page visits in the last 7 days divided by total site visits." This ratio captures engagement intensity much better than a simple page view count.

Good feature engineering is often the difference between a mediocre AI lead score calculation and one that consistently identifies your best opportunities. Teams that invest time in crafting the right features see significantly better model performance.

Model Training

With clean, engineered features in place, the algorithm trains on your historical data. It examines leads that converted and leads that did not, then identifies the patterns that separate the two groups.

Common algorithms used in AI lead score calculation include:

  • Logistic regression: simple, interpretable, works well with smaller datasets and gives you clear feature weights
  • Random forests: handles complex interactions between variables and is resistant to overfitting
  • Gradient boosting (XGBoost, LightGBM): delivers high accuracy for large datasets with many features
  • Neural networks: best for very large datasets where non-linear relationships between features matter most

The model outputs a probability score, typically between 0 and 100, representing how likely a lead is to convert within a defined time window.

Score Calibration and Thresholds

Raw probability scores need context to be useful. Most teams define threshold bands that map scores to actions:

  • 80 to 100 (Hot): Route immediately to sales for personal outreach. These leads show strong buying signals.
  • 50 to 79 (Warm): Continue nurturing with targeted content and automated sequences. They are interested but not ready.
  • Below 50 (Cold): Keep in general marketing workflows or deprioritize. Focus your team's energy elsewhere.

These thresholds should be calibrated against your actual conversion data. What works for a SaaS company with a 14-day sales cycle will look very different from an enterprise company with 9-month deals.

Continuous Learning

The best AI lead scoring systems do not stay static. They retrain periodically, incorporating new conversion data so the model adapts to changing buyer behavior. This feedback loop is what makes the AI lead score calculation method fundamentally better than rule-based systems over time. As your market shifts, the model shifts with it.

AI Lead Score Calculation Formula: Breaking It Down

While the specifics vary by algorithm, the core AI lead score calculation formula follows a weighted probability model:

Lead Score = f(w1*x1 + w2*x2 + w3*x3 + ... + wn*xn)

Where x1 through xn are your input features (page visits, email opens, company size, and so on), w1 through wn are the learned weights the model assigns to each feature, and f() is an activation function like sigmoid that converts the weighted sum into a probability between 0 and 1.

The key difference from traditional scoring is that the weights are not set by a marketing manager in a spreadsheet. They are learned from data. The algorithm might determine that "visited pricing page 3+ times" deserves a weight of 0.82, while "opened newsletter" only gets 0.12, because the data shows the first behavior is a much stronger conversion signal.

Here is a simplified example of how an AI lead score calculation method might weight different signals:

  • Requested a demo: weight 0.85
  • Visited pricing page 3+ times in 7 days: weight 0.78
  • Matches ICP company size: weight 0.65
  • Downloaded a case study: weight 0.45
  • Opened marketing email: weight 0.15
  • Unsubscribed from emails: weight -0.70

Notice the negative weight for unsubscribing. Predictive lead scoring captures disqualification signals too, which is something most manual scoring systems ignore entirely.

4 Types of AI Lead Scoring Models

Not all AI lead scoring models work the same way. Depending on your goals, you might use one or combine several of these approaches.

1. Purchase Intent Scoring

This model focuses on buying signals. It tracks behaviors that historically precede a purchase, such as visiting pricing pages, comparing plans, reading case studies, or engaging with bottom-of-funnel content. Intent scoring is ideal for sales teams that want to know "who is ready to buy right now." The AI lead score calculation method applied to intent data can surface leads that are days away from a decision.

2. ICP Fit Scoring

Ideal Customer Profile scoring evaluates how well a lead matches your best customer profile. It weighs firmographic attributes like company size, industry, technology stack, and annual revenue. A lead might show high engagement but score low on ICP fit if they are outside your target market. Combining ICP fit with intent scoring gives you the most complete and reliable picture of lead quality.

3. Engagement Scoring

Engagement scoring measures the depth and frequency of a lead's interactions with your brand. It goes beyond simple activity counts to evaluate the quality of engagement. Reading three blog posts about pricing is scored differently than reading three blog posts about industry news. This model helps identify leads who are actively researching solutions in your category.

4. Negative Scoring

This is the model most teams overlook, and it can be just as valuable as the others. Negative scoring identifies patterns associated with leads that churn, go dark, or turn out to be poor fits. Signals might include repeated support page visits (indicating product confusion), email unsubscribes, or prolonged inactivity after initial engagement. Negative scoring helps your team stop wasting time on leads that look good on paper but will not convert.

AI Lead Score Calculation Method for B2B Sales

B2B sales introduces complexity that consumer-facing scoring does not have to deal with. Here is how the AI lead score calculation method adapts for B2B environments.

Account-Level vs. Contact-Level Scoring

In B2B, buying decisions involve multiple stakeholders. An account-level scoring approach aggregates signals from every contact at a company into a single account score. This prevents situations where individual contacts score low because they only handle part of the research process, while the account as a whole is actively evaluating your solution.

Modern CRM tools for B2B companies often include built-in account scoring capabilities that roll up contact-level signals into a unified view.

Multi-Touch Attribution in Scoring

B2B sales cycles involve many touchpoints across weeks or months. The AI lead score calculation method for B2B needs to account for the cumulative effect of interactions rather than over-weighting the most recent touch. Time-decay models, where recent interactions carry more weight than older ones, are the most common approach. This gives credit to earlier touchpoints while still reflecting current engagement levels.

Data Volume Requirements

A question that comes up often: how much data do you need? For reliable AI lead scoring, aim for at least 1,000 closed deals (both won and lost) in your training dataset. Fewer than that and your model will not have enough examples to learn meaningful patterns. Companies with smaller datasets can start with simpler models like logistic regression and graduate to more complex algorithms as data accumulates.

How to Implement AI Lead Scoring: Step by Step

Getting automated lead scoring right takes more than just plugging in a tool. Here is a practical implementation roadmap based on what actually works.

  1. Audit your data. Start by evaluating the quality and completeness of your CRM data. Look for gaps in firmographic fields, inconsistent naming conventions, and duplicate records. The AI lead score calculation method is only as good as the data it learns from.
  2. Define your conversion events. What counts as a "converted" lead? A demo booking? A signed contract? A qualified opportunity? Be precise. The model needs a clear target variable to optimize against.
  3. Choose your platform. You have three main paths: CRM-native scoring (HubSpot, Salesforce Einstein), standalone platforms (Demandbase, MadKudu, 6sense), or custom-built models for teams with data science resources.
  4. Train and validate. Split your historical data into training and testing sets (typically 80/20). Train the model and evaluate accuracy using precision, recall, and AUC-ROC metrics. A good model should achieve an AUC-ROC above 0.75.
  5. Get sales team buy-in. Run a pilot with a small group. Show side-by-side comparisons of AI scores vs. their gut instinct. Use explainable AI techniques so reps can see why a lead scored high or low.
  6. Monitor and retrain. Set up a quarterly review cadence. Compare predicted scores against actual outcomes. Watch for model drift and retrain every 3 to 6 months.

Many of the top lead generation tools now include built-in AI scoring features, making implementation faster for teams that do not want to build from scratch.

Common Pitfalls to Avoid

Even the best AI lead score calculation method will fail if you fall into these common traps.

Data Quality Issues

The number one reason AI scoring fails is bad data. Incomplete fields, outdated records, and inconsistent formatting all introduce noise that the model treats as signal. Clean your data before you start, and set up ongoing data hygiene processes to keep it clean.

Bias in Training Data

If your historical data reflects biased prospecting (for example, your team only pursued enterprise accounts), the model will learn that bias and penalize SMB leads regardless of their actual conversion potential. Audit your training data for representation gaps before you train.

Ignoring Model Drift

Markets change. Buyer behavior evolves. A model trained on last year's data might not perform well today. Schedule regular retraining and track accuracy metrics over time so you catch degradation early.

Skipping Change Management

AI scoring is a people problem as much as a technology problem. If your sales reps do not trust the scores, they will not use them. Invest in training, create feedback loops for reps to flag bad scores, and iterate based on their input. The best lead scoring machine learning model in the world is useless if nobody acts on the scores.

Frequently Asked Questions

What is the AI lead score calculation method?

The AI lead score calculation method is a machine learning approach that analyzes historical conversion data and lead attributes to assign a numerical score predicting how likely a lead is to become a customer. Unlike manual scoring systems that rely on fixed point values, it learns and adapts from data patterns automatically, improving over time as more conversion data becomes available.

How is an AI lead score calculated?

An AI lead score is calculated by feeding lead attributes (demographics, behavior, engagement, firmographics) into a trained machine learning model. The model applies learned weights to each attribute and outputs a probability score, typically on a 0 to 100 scale, representing conversion likelihood. The weights are determined by the algorithm based on which factors historically correlated with successful conversions.

What data do you need for AI lead scoring?

At minimum, you need historical CRM data with closed-won and closed-lost outcomes, along with lead attributes like job title, company size, industry, and behavioral data such as website visits and email engagement. For reliable results, aim for at least 1,000 closed deals in your training dataset. Third-party intent data and enrichment data can further improve accuracy.

How accurate is AI lead scoring compared to manual scoring?

AI lead scoring typically outperforms manual scoring by 30 to 50 percent in identifying leads that convert. This is because AI can analyze hundreds of variables simultaneously and detect non-obvious patterns that human-created rule systems miss. The accuracy gap widens as more data becomes available and the model goes through retraining cycles.

How often should you retrain an AI lead scoring model?

Most teams retrain their AI lead scoring models every 3 to 6 months. However, if you notice a significant drop in prediction accuracy or if your market conditions change (new product launch, shift in target audience), you should retrain sooner. Continuous monitoring of precision and recall metrics helps you know exactly when retraining is needed.